Caldwell National Honor Society To Sponsor 5K For Breast Cancer Awareness


The Caldwell County High School National Honor Society will host a 5K run to support breast cancer awareness on Saturday, October 28.
Keegan Miller with the National Honor Society said they are trying to host community events again, following the COVID-19 pandemic.


Taylor Wynn, also an NHS member, added this is a way for their Club to give back to the community.


Miller said those who participate will have their name entered for prizes to be given away during the event.


Wynn added they are taking sign-ups before the event, or you can register the day of and there will also be an option to participate in a 1-mile walk. Community members are also welcome to watch the activities and donate to show your support.


Zach East serves as the teacher advisor for the local National Honor Society chapter for his first year. He noted sometimes youth get a bad reputation, but he has found this group of students are caring and supportive of the community and want to make things better for all citizens.


The National Honor Society Warrior Run for Breast Cancer Awareness will again be held on Saturday, October 28, from 8:00 to 11:00 a.m. at the Caldwell County High School Track. Additional details can be found here or by calling (270) 365-8010.
